* Position Overview:

** This position is primarily responsible for supporting the Bank’s business plan and established goals through customary activity including outside calls to current and potential customers. The incumbent provides the highest quality service to every customer.
*
* Primary Responsibilities:

** Manages and services existing clients and Bank customers and builds stronger existing customer relationships by learning customers’ individual financial needs and supplying the appropriate product. Actively pursues the acquisition of new clients from both internal referrals and external sources selling various investment products.

Identifies potential sales opportunities and acts upon them by initiating an Investment product with the customer or referring the customer to another line of business such as Trust, Insurance or loans.

Identifies opportunities for Associate Financial Advisors to have additional training in customer profiling, sales skills or meeting goals. Demonstrates knowledge in all disciplines within Wealth Management and cross-refers customers and prospects and Retail bank products to Retail.

Maintains all client files, completes all required Continuing Education (CE) and Financial Industry Regulatory Authority (FINRA) licensing.

Reviews the work of licensed bankers for accuracy, completeness and compliance with government regulations attached to the various licenses they hold.

Performs other related duties and projects as assigned.

** Minimum Level of Education Required to Perform the Primary Responsibilities of this Position:
** High School or GED     
** Minimum # of Years of Job Related Experience Required to Perform the Primary Responsibilities of this Position:
** 3     
** Skills Required to Perform the Primary Responsibilities of this Position:
** Excellent management skills   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al   Excellent organizational, analytical and interpersonal skills   Excellent customer service skills   Ability to use a personal computer and job-related software   MS Word - Basic Level   MS Excel - Intermediate Level   MS PowerPoint - Basic Level        
** Licensures/Certifications Required to Perform the Primary Responsibilities of this Position:
** Life/Health and FINRA Series 7 and 63 & 65 or S66.
